(http://u-turnusa.com FLAT TOP PARAMOTOR) Powered Paragliding expert Dell Schanze / SUPERDELL sets a Powered Paragliding world's first with both a death spiral launch and landing draging the tip of his glider on the ground. Powered Skydiving is the sport of the 21st century with the WPSDA certified Flat Top Paramotor from Revolution Paramotors and the CEN-C Certified Antea from Sky Paragliders.
